Decorations: Classic Twinkle or Modern Glow?
Classic Twinkle:
– Warm, nostalgic glow
– Evokes childhood memories
– Can be personalized with family heirlooms
Modern Glow:
– Sleek, sophisticated aesthetics
– Energy-efficient LEDs save money and the environment
– Can be customized with smart lighting systems
Gift-Giving: Sentimental Surprises or Practical Pleasures?
Sentimental Surprises:
– Focus on emotional value rather than material worth
– Thoughtful and unique presents that create lasting memories
– Can include handmade crafts, personalized items, or experiences
Practical Pleasures:
– Focus on meeting specific needs and desires
– Gifts that solve problems, enhance daily life, or provide enjoyment
– Can include appliances, electronics, or gift certificates to favorite stores
Festivities: Gatherings or Getaway?
Gatherings:
– Bring loved ones together for shared moments
– Foster a sense of community and togetherness
– Can involve holiday dinners, parties, or religious services
Getaway:
– Escape the hustle and bustle for relaxation and rejuvenation
– Create new memories in a different setting
– Can be a warm-weather destination, a cozy cabin, or a festive city
Dining: Festive Feast or Casual Comfort?
Festive Feast:
– Elaborate multi-course meals
– Culinary creations that showcase traditional flavors and dishes
– Can involve extensive planning and preparation
Casual Comfort:
– Quick and easy meals that emphasize convenience
– Focus on comfort foods and favorite holiday treats
– Gives more time to spend with loved ones and less time in the kitchen
Entertainment: Holiday Classics or Modern Festivities?
Holiday Classics:
– Time-honored movies, music, and TV specials
– Create a sense of nostalgia and familiarity
– Offer a shared experience for generations
Modern Festivities:
– New and innovative forms of entertainment
– Interactive experiences, virtual holiday events, and streaming specials
– Keep the holiday spirit fresh and exciting
Choosing This or That
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ual preferences, motivations, and circumstances. Consider your family traditions, your personal style, and the overall atmosphere you want to create.
Advantages of Tradition:
- Nostalgia and familiarity evoke positive emotions
- Strengthens family bonds through shared experiences
- Preserves cultural heritage and values
Drawbacks of Tradition:
- Can be limiting and uninspiring
- May not reflect current preferences or lifestyles
- May lead to boredom or a sense of routine
Advantages of Innovation:
- Creates new memories and keeps the holidays fresh and exciting
- Allows for personalization and self-expression
- Can accommodate changing lifestyles and needs
Drawbacks of Innovation:
- Can be disruptive to cherished traditions
- May require more planning and effort
- May not be suitable for all family members or generations
